Five-time Emmy Award-winning Devine Entertainment Corporation develops, produces and distributes children's and family entertainment for the theatrical motion picture, television and Video/DVD marketplace worldwide. Their film series on landmark Composers', Inventors' and Artists' are critically acclaimed and broadcast in over 50 countries. The Company's first feature film Bailey's Billion$, is slated for worldwide distribution in 2005. Headquartered in Toronto, the Company's common shares trade under the symbol DVNN on the Canadian Unlisted Board (CUB) and on the NASD OTC PK market in the U.S. under the symbol DVNNF.
